Chocolate cafe set to open third London location in sweet post-lockdown plans
A UK chocolate cafe has announced that it is opening its third London venue in March.
Knoops, which specialises in chocolate based drinks, will open the new King’s Road site once the national lockdown is lifted.
While in lockdown, Knoops has continued to expand its online shop and offer a takeaway service when restrictions have allowed.
The company said: “Like its sister sites, the King’s Road outpost will have a contemporary feel; think wooden materials, a soft colour palette, and an abundance of natural light thanks to the store front’s floor-to-ceiling windows.
“In store, Jens [Knoops, founder] is constantly developing Knoops’ chocolate library, drawing on his love of chocolate and spending nearly a decade perfecting his beloved drinks – and he’ll bring bring Knoops’ beloved hot chocolates to King’s Road as well as chocolate shakes this summer.
